The Chupacabra and the Internet: The Myth’s Dissemination and Perpetuation Online
The Chupacabra and the Internet: The Myth's Dissemination and Perpetuation Online The Chupacabra and the Internet: The Myth's Dissemination and Perpetuation Online I. Introduction The Chupacabra, a creature steeped in…